Elon Musk has declared that advancing artificial intelligence will render retirement savings obsolete, a claim that arrives at a moment when the ancient human bargain between labor, time, and security is already under quiet renegotiation. The assertion rests on a vision of AI-generated abundance so complete that scarcity itself dissolves — and with it, the need to set anything aside for old age. Yet history reminds us that technological revolutions have rarely distributed their gifts evenly, and the distance between a bold prediction and a lived reality is measured not in ideas but in decades

Impacto Geopolítico
Musk's claim that AI will eliminate retirement savings needs reflects tech-sector optimism but poses geopolitical risks to social security systems and economic stability across developed nations.
Tech billionaires increasingly shape economic policy discourse, potentially shifting power from democratic institutions to private sector visionaries. AI advancement concentrates wealth among tech leaders, challenging traditional welfare state models and creating ideological tensions between automation advocates and labor-protection advocates.
Similar to early industrial revolution claims that mechanization would eliminate work scarcity—instead creating new labor markets and social disruption requiring regulatory intervention.
Lente Económico
Musk's claim that AI advancement will eliminate retirement savings needs challenges traditional financial planning and social security systems, with uncertain economic viability.
If AI-driven abundance materializes, consumers could reduce retirement savings, reducing demand for financial products and potentially destabilizing pension systems. However, this remains speculative; most households will likely continue traditional retirement planning in the near-to-medium term, creating uncertainty in financial decision-making.
Governments may need to reconsider social security frameworks, tax incentives for retirement savings, and labor market policies if AI significantly disrupts employment and income generation. Regulatory bodies may scrutinize claims about AI's economic impact to prevent consumer financial planning errors.
